Frequently Asked Questions
🚇 🗺️ Getting There
Percheles Beach is located near Mazarrón in the Region of Murcia. It's often described as being off the beaten track. Access is typically by car, with a large, free parking area available. Follow local signage for Playa de Percheles.
While it's a bit isolated, it's well worth the visit. Travelers describe it as a hidden gem and an oasis. Using GPS coordinates or a reliable navigation app is recommended.
Public transport options are limited due to its isolated location. It's best accessed by private vehicle. Local buses may serve nearby towns like Mazarrón, requiring a taxi or further travel to reach the beach.
The road leading to the beach is generally accessible by car. The parking area is on rough ground, which is typical for more natural, less developed beaches.
The closest major town is Mazarrón. You can find amenities and accommodation there before heading to the more secluded Percheles Beach.
🎫 🎫 Tickets & Entry
No, Percheles Beach is a free public beach. There are no entrance fees to access the sand or the water.
As a natural beach, Percheles Beach is open 24/7. However, the beach bar (Chiringuito Parazuelos 16) will have its own operating hours, typically during daylight and evening hours in peak season.
No booking is required for Percheles Beach. It's a natural beach accessible to all visitors.
The main restriction noted is that campers and motorhomes are not allowed to park overnight due to height barriers in the car park.
Information on specific accessibility features is limited. As a natural beach with a rough parking area, it may present challenges. It's advisable to check locally or visit during less crowded times.
🎫 🧭 Onsite Experience
There are toilets available, and a beach bar (Chiringuito Parazuelos 16) operates during the summer months, offering refreshments.
Yes, the waters are shallow, clear, and warm, making it ideal for swimming, especially for families.
The area is noted as being good for rock pooling, offering a chance to explore marine life.
The beach features pleasant, soft, golden sand, which is great for relaxing and sunbathing.
It can get very busy in July and August, but it's much quieter in late September and October. Weekdays are generally less crowded than weekends.

Best Times to Visit Percheles Beach for Optimal Experience
For those who prioritize tranquility above all else, the shoulder seasons are ideal. Late September and early October are frequently recommended by travelers. During this time, the crowds thin out significantly, the sea remains warm and clear, and the overall ambiance is one of peaceful relaxation. Easter time is also mentioned as a period when the beach is quiet and pleasant.
Visiting during sunrise is also a popular choice for photographers and early risers, offering a magical start to the day with soft, beautiful light. Regardless of when you choose to visit, Percheles Beach promises a refreshing escape into nature's beauty.
